Doing any of the following after

pressing the MEMO button will

cancel the storing procedure.

Not pressing a memory button

within 5 seconds.

Readjusting the seat position.

Readjusting the outside mirror

position.

Each memory button stores only one

driving position. Storing a new

position erases the previous setting

stored in that button’s memory. If

you want to add a new position while

retaining the current one, use the

other memory button.

To stop the system’s automatic

adjustment, do any of these actions:

Press any button on the control

panel: MEMO, 1, or 2.

Push any of the adjustment

switches for the seat.

Shift out of Park.

Adjust the outside mirrors.

Make sure the vehicle is parked.

Press the desired memory button

(1 or 2) until you hear a beep, then

release the button.

If desired, you can use the

adjustment switches to change the

positions of the seat, steering wheel

or outside mirrors after they are in

their memorized position. If you

change the memorized position, the

indicator in the memory button will

go out. To keep this driving position

for later use, you must store it in the

driving position memory.

The system will move the seat,

steering wheel, and outside mirrors

to the memorized positions. The

indicator in the selected memory

button will flash during movement.

When the adjustments are complete,

you will hear two beeps, and the

indicator will remain on.
